What is the typical cost of preschool in Cornersville, TN, and are there any financial assistance programs available?

In Cornersville, monthly preschool tuition typically ranges from $150 to $300, depending on the program's hours and curriculum. For state-funded assistance, Tennessee's Voluntary Pre-K (VPK) program is available at Cornersville Elementary School for eligible 4-year-olds at no cost. Additionally, some local private providers may offer sliding scale fees or accept Department of Human Services child care certificates for qualifying families.

What types of preschool programs are available in Cornersville, from structured to play-based?

Cornersville offers a mix of program philosophies, primarily through its public school VPK program, which follows a structured, school-readiness model, and private in-home or church-based preschools that often emphasize play-based and faith-based learning. Given the rural setting, most programs are part-day, with the public VPK being a free, full-school-day option. It's important to visit and ask about the daily schedule to see the balance of guided instruction and free play.

How do I ensure a preschool in Cornersville is licensed and meets safety standards?

All licensed child care providers in Cornersville must comply with Tennessee Department of Human Services (TDHS) regulations. You can verify a program's license and review any inspection reports online through the TDHS Child Care Agency Search tool. For added peace of mind, ask the director about staff-to-child ratios, background checks for all employees, and their emergency procedures for situations like severe weather common in Marshall County.

What are the enrollment timelines and age cut-offs for preschools in Cornersville, particularly for the public Pre-K?

Enrollment for the Tennessee Voluntary Pre-K at Cornersville Elementary School typically opens in early spring for the following fall semester, with a priority for children who turn 4 by August 15th. Private preschools in the area may have more flexible timelines and age requirements, often accepting children from ages 3 to 5. It's crucial to contact programs directly by January or February, as spots, especially in the free public program, can fill quickly in this small community.

As a rural town, what should I consider regarding location, transportation, and hours when choosing a Cornersville preschool?

Given Cornersville's rural nature, proximity is key, as most preschools do not provide transportation. The public VPK at the elementary school may offer bus service for its full-day program, which is a significant advantage for families without mid-day transport. Private options often have shorter, half-day schedules (e.g., 8:30 AM - 12:00 PM), so you'll need to plan for drop-off and pick-up logistics that fit your work commute, possibly to nearby larger towns like Lewisburg.

The beauty of exploring private pre-k programs lies in the diversity of approaches you can find. Some may focus on a play-based philosophy, where learning numbers and letters is woven seamlessly into imaginative play and social interaction. Others might incorporate a more structured curriculum, ensuring specific school-readiness skills are nurtured. As you begin your search, think about your child's temperament. Do they thrive in free exploration, or do they respond well to gentle routines? Visiting a school gives you the best feel. Don't hesitate to schedule a tour, observe a classroom in action, and ask about the typical day. Notice if the children seem engaged and happy, and if the teachers are interacting at the children's eye level, fostering a warm and supportive connection.

Beyond the educational philosophy, practical considerations are key for busy Tennessee families. Inquire about schedules—do they offer full-day or half-day programs that fit your work life? Ask about their policies on communication; a good private pre-k will keep you informed with regular updates, whether through an app, a newsletter, or quick chats at pickup. Consider the logistics, like the safety of the drop-off/pick-up procedure and whether snacks or meals are provided. These daily details greatly impact your family's rhythm.

One of the greatest advantages of a local private pre-k is the opportunity for your child to form friendships within our community, building social confidence before entering the larger school system. Look for programs that encourage this through group activities, shared projects, and perhaps even family events. Ask how they handle social-emotional learning, which is just as critical as academic prep. Skills like taking turns, expressing feelings, and solving small conflicts are the bedrock of a positive school experience.
